All Best Rune Combos in Roblox The Forge

Best Weapon Combo

  • Drain Edge + Frost Spec II

This setup allows you to freeze enemies while constantly healing through lifesteal. It is one of the strongest combinations for boss fights and elite enemies.
Best sub-stat priority for weapon runes is attack speed.

Best Armor Combo

  • Briar Notch + Vitality

Damage reflection combined with higher HP provides excellent survivability. Alternative mobility option:

  • Stride + Surge for faster movement and exploration.

Best Pickaxe Combo

  • Mining Shard II with Mining Power or Luck

If Tier II is unavailable, use Mining Shard I with the best possible roll.

Best Weapon Runes in Roblox The Forge

Weapon runes focus on damage output, extra effects, and sustain during combat.

1. Flame Spark

Flame Spark applies a burn effect that deals around 5–10% of your base damage per second. It has a 15–25% chance to trigger and lasts for 1–2 seconds. Drop sources:

  • Reaper
  • Death Axe Skeleton
  • Fire Slime

This rune is solid for early game and mob clearing, but it becomes less effective later since burn damage does not scale well.

2. Drain Edge

Drain Edge is currently the strongest lifesteal rune in the game. It heals you for 4–11% of the damage dealt, with a cap of 5% HP per hit. Drop source:

  • Reaper (World 2 – Lava Zone)

This rune is extremely powerful when paired with high attack speed. It is ideal for solo farming and boss fights because it greatly improves survivability.

3. Venom Rune

Venom Rune applies poison damage equal to 4–7% of weapon damage per second. The effect lasts 3–6 seconds and has a 25–35% activation chance. Drop source:

  • Blight Pyromancer (Wizard Skeleton, World 2)

Venom Rune performs well in long fights, especially against bosses, due to its consistent damage over time.

4. Blast Chip

Blast Chip triggers an area explosion that deals 20–40% weapon damage, with an 8–20% chance per hit. Drop source:

  • Bomber

This rune is excellent for farming large groups of enemies and clearing areas quickly.

5. Frost Spec I & II

Frost runes can freeze enemies for 1–3 seconds with a 9–20% chance. These effects do not stack and have a long cooldown. Drop sources:

  • All World 3 mobs (Tier I)
  • Golem Boss (Tier II)

Frost runes are more useful for control and utility rather than raw damage.


Best Armor Runes for Defense and Survivability

Armor runes help reduce incoming damage and keep your character alive longer.

1. Briar Notch

Briar Notch reflects 2–10% of damage taken back to enemies, with a very short cooldown. Drop sources:

  • Death Axe Skeleton
  • Elite Death Axe Skeleton (World 2)

This rune is great for defensive builds and areas with heavy mob density.

2. Rage Mark

When your HP drops below 35%, Rage Mark grants a 12–26% boost to damage and movement speed for 4–6 seconds. Drop sources:

  • Elite Skeleton Rogue
  • Common Orc

This rune is perfect for aggressive playstyles and clutch boss situations.

3. Ward Patch

Ward Patch reduces incoming damage by 6–14% with a 5–15% activation chance. How to obtain:

  • Tutorial reward (one-time only)

Many players miss this rune early and sell it by mistake, even though it is very valuable.


Pickaxe Runes for Faster Farming

Pickaxe runes improve mining efficiency and resource farming.

1. Mining Shard I

Provides sub-stats such as luck, yield, mining speed, or mining power. Drop sources:

  • Delver Zombie (World 1)
  • Bomber (World 2)

This rune is essential for faster early progression.

2. Mining Shard II

An upgraded version that can roll one or two sub-stats at once. Drop source:

  • Golem Boss

This is an endgame farming rune, but it has a very low drop rate.
